Middle English
Alternative forms
Etymology
From Old English ecged; equivalent to egge (“edge”) + -ed.
Pronunciation
Adjective
egged
- (in compounds) Having an edge of a certain type.
- (rare) Having an edge; edged or bladed.
Descendants
- English: edged
